Episode 56: The Curious Case of Dennis Wideman

Chris Johnston joins the show to discuss the bizarre situation that resulted in Dennis Wideman’s 20-game suspension, and how it raises bigger questions about the faulty concussion protocol the league currently has in place.

We also look into Sidney Crosby’s resurgence since a slow start to the year, whether Connor McDavid could (and should) make a comeback to win the Calder Trophy, and if the loser point will cause something of a gridlock on trade deadline day.
